This morning I left the house with a red sunrise in the east. I headed north across our property, then the neighbors, now onto public land. It’s woods as far as one can see, making the deer density low this time of year. The snow is very crunchy. I’ve only cut one buck track but I think this is a hike for exercise verse hunting at this point.

I visited one of my favorite places within walking distance of my house. An old school bus that was to be a part of a ski area. The plan was to use the old busses as warming sheds. This is the only one left, it used to have a Woodstove in it but it looks like someone decided they needed it pretty badly. The bus sits on a ridge that is only as wide as the bus, it is surrounded by a wooded bowl on 90% of it, making it a good vantage point. There are lots of turkeys back here and every year I do battle with a Wiley old tom in this area. IMG_0335.jpegIMG_0336.jpegIMG_0337.jpeg
